As you are well aware, we are going to be in for another tough summer, some more than others especially in the Country regions, the ongoing drought is forcing some clubs to think about alternatives such as synthetic greens.
The newly formed VGA Committee has proposed to give Bowls Clubs another alternative other than just synthetics as an answer to their problems by compiling an Information Book. This Book would contain information such as:

All current information about the Government Grants Scheme to convert natural grass surfaces from cool season grasses to more drought tolerant warm season grasses. (A Grant not applicable to synthetics)
A basic description of construction methods including the new design at Highton Bowls Club.
A current Index and contact details of all Greenkeepers, Contractors & Turf related Companies involved in the Maintenance & Construction of Bowling Greens that wish to participate in the book.
A list of Bowls Clubs that currently have couch Greens so that interested Clubs can see these surfaces for themselves.
Provide a brief description of warm season grasses & their advantages.


The VGA Committee is about to enter into discussions with the RVBA to ask them to help support us in this venture &  to include the book in one of it’s many official mail outs to all Bowls Club Secretaries throughout the state.
